The Call for Variety

user Sdraco134 expresses a common feeling among players, stating “I enjoy the pyramid design, but having three raids and a dungeon with it feels excessive, I must admit.” This indicates that the community is growing weary due to the frequent recurrence of similar visual themes. Although many still admire the mysterious allure of pyramids, the repetition is starting to diminish the initial excitement. The primary concern lies not just in aesthetics but in the yearning for a fresh storyline and immersive environments. Players are seeking out settings that spark their imagination, offering an experience that doesn’t feel like a repetition of what they’ve already encountered. The unique aspects found in past raids inspire the community to push for innovation: fans want to explore dungeons that respond to their awe and stimulate their senses afresh.
